Publication

RIF-1, a novel nuclear receptor corepressor that associates with the nuclear matrix.

Li HJ, Haque ZK, Chen A, Mendelsohn M

The retinoic acid receptors (RARs) are ligand-dependent transcription factors that play critical roles in cell differentiation, embryonic development, and tumor suppression. RAR transcriptional activities are mediated by a growing family of nuclear receptor (NR) coregulators. Here we report the cloning and characterization of a novel protein RIF1 (receptor interacting factor) that interacts with RARalpha in vivo and in vitro. RIF1 ... [more]

J. Cell. Biochem. Nov. 01, 2007; 102(4);1021-35 [Pubmed: 17455211]
